
Explosion Defeat Tacoma with 40-Point Fourth Quarter 109-103 and Pick up All Star Center
May 3, 2008 - International Basketball League (IBL)
Snohomish County Explosion News Release
MONROE, Wash. - May 2nd, 2008 - The Snohomish County Explosion Basketball Team got back to back wins in league play with a 109-103 win down in Tacoma. On Friday night, the team won behind Jamaal Miller, Chris Keller and Donald Watts' great shooting and defense. The game was a battle with the Explosion being down by as many as 10 points in the third quarter. But veteran point guard Greg Hendricks was key for a comeback win now his second game in a row playing the point for the Snohomish County Explosion in closing minutes. The Explosion also picked up All Star power forward Alex Adediran previous on the Tacoma squad for the remaining of the season. Alex had limited minutes in his first game for the Explosion. Dwight Edwards former assistant coach for the Explosion is now coaching on the bench for Tacoma. This is an exchange the Explosion are very happy with and Tacoma has a quality coach on the bench to help reshape the Jazz.
Saturday night should be a barn burner with the instant rival Bellingham Slam hosting the Explosion for one last time during the regular season. Ryan Diggs and Jacob Stevenson have proved to be a thorn in the side of the Explosion all year, and this weekend should be no different. The trio of Watts, Miller, and Weakley have had great success against the Slam so far, and the additions of Justin White, Troy Gywnn, and Greg Hendricks could make this the game of the year so far in the IBL.
There is no love lost between these two teams who have battled to the last second in all three contests so far. The Explosion will be looking to even the season series with a win on Saturday.
